What is the right to non-discrimination based on disability in the field of housing in Argentina?

In Argentina, all people have the right not to be discriminated against on the basis of disability in access to housing. This implies that a person cannot be denied access to adequate housing or limit their housing opportunities because of their disability. Equal opportunities, universal accessibility and the guarantee of inclusive housing adapted to the needs of people with disabilities are promoted.

Can a Child Support Debtor in the Dominican Republic request a review of child support if his or her income is affected by a global economic crisis?

Yes, a Child Support Debtor in the Dominican Republic can request a review of child support if his or her income is affected by a global economic crisis. The court will consider these circumstances and may adjust support obligations if it is shown that the economic crisis affects the debtor's ability to pay support.

What is the entity in charge of maintaining and managing risk lists in Panama?

The Financial Analysis Unit (UAF) of Panama is the entity in charge of maintaining and managing the risk lists.
